Hygiene pests
Typical hygiene pests include pests that can transmit pathogens to humans and animals, mainly through their excrement.
Typical hygiene pests include flies, rats, mice, cockroaches, bed bugs, fleas, pigeon ticks, and pharaoh ants.
Material pests
These pests destroy textiles, wool, leather, wood, natural products, and everyday objects. In addition to rodents (rats and mice), which can cause short circuits or even fires by gnawing on electrical cables, clothes moths, carpet beetles, and brass beetles are also considered material pests.
Storage pests
Cereal products, baked goods, nuts, and protein-rich foods are primarily affected by storage pests. Meat and dairy products, as well as dried fruits, spices, teas, and chocolate, are among the preferred foods of these pests. Feces, webs, and secretions often render food inedible. Food and luxury foods are often already infested with pests when purchased, without this being apparent to the layman. Under suitable conditions, pests often multiply en masse in a very short time.
Commonly found storage pests include rats, mice, food moths, moths in general, and various types of beetles such as grain beetles, rice weevils, cereal beetles, and other beetles and their larvae.
Nuisance pests
Nuisance pests are animals and insects that do not pose a direct health risk to humans and livestock. Nuisance pests cause little damage to food or materials, but when they appear, we find them annoying, disgusting, or frightening.
Typical nuisance pests include wasps, hornets, vinegar flies, silverfish, dust mites, book scorpions, and woodlice.
Parasites
Human parasites are parasites that infest humans. Many bacteria and fungi also fall under the definition of parasites. However, due to their medical significance and their sometimes only facultative parasitism, they are dealt with in the fields of bacteriology and mycology within microbiology. Many parasites often transmit other parasites, in which case the former are considered vectors. Infectious diseases that can be transmitted from an animal to a human or from a human to an animal are referred to as zoonoses. It is noteworthy that most stages of development of most parasites can be killed by simple pasteurization for a few minutes at 60 °C, but that some can survive even prolonged deep freezing at temperatures around minus 20 °C.

Marten repellent is usually divided into two stages:
Stage 1: Repelling the marten by dusting with Super Expel, which consists of purely natural ingredients without chemical additives. Can be used in attics, under roofs, garages, garden sheds, etc.
Stage 2: Sealing/closing all possible entry points for martens throughout the entire roof area.
